8.254 V$GES_BLOCKING_ENQUEUE

V$GES_BLOCKING_ENQUEUEは、現在ロック・マネージャが把握している、ブロックされているか他をブロックしているすべてのロックの情報を示します。

このビューの出力は、V$GES_ENQUEUEからの出力のサブセットです。これはOracle Real Application Clustersビューです。

関連項目:

ロック・マネージャが把握しているすべてのロックについては、V$GES_ENQUEUEを参照してください。

データ型 説明

HANDLE

RAW(4 | 8)

ロック・ポインタ

GRANT_LEVEL

VARCHAR2(9)

ロックの権限付与レベル

REQUEST_LEVEL

VARCHAR2(9)

ロックの要求レベル

RESOURCE_NAME1

VARCHAR2(30)

ロックのリソース名

RESOURCE_NAME2

VARCHAR2(30)

ロックのリソース名

PID

NUMBER

ロックを保持するプロセス識別子

TRANSACTION_ID0

NUMBER

ロックが属するトランザクション識別子の下位4バイト

TRANSACTION_ID1

NUMBER

ロックが属するトランザクション識別子の上位4バイト

GROUP_ID

NUMBER

ロックのグループ識別子

OPEN_OPT_DEADLOCK

NUMBER

DEADLOCKオープン・オプションが設定されている場合は1、設定されていない場合は0

OPEN_OPT_PERSISTENT

NUMBER

PERSISTENTオープン・オプションが設定されている場合は1、設定されていない場合は0

OPEN_OPT_PROCESS_OWNED

NUMBER

PROCESS_OWNEDオープン・オプションが設定されている場合は1、設定されていない場合は0

OPEN_OPT_NO_XID

NUMBER

NO_XIDオープン・オ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_GETVALUE

NUMBER

GETVALUE変換オ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_PUTVALUE

NUMBER

PUTVALUE変換オ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_NOVALUE

NUMBER

NOVALUE変換オ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_DUBVALUE

NUMBER

DUBVALUE変換オ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_NOQUEUE

NUMBER

NOQUEUE変換オ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_EXPRESS

NUMBER

EXPRESS変換オ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_NODEADLOCKWAIT

NUMBER

NODEADLOCKWAIT変換オプションが設定されている場合は1、設定されていない場合は0

CONVERT_OPT_NODEADLOCKBLOCK

NUMBER

NODEADLOCKBLOCK変換オプションが設定されている場合は1、設定されていない場合は0

WHICH_QUEUE

NUMBER

現在ロックが存在するキュー。NULLキューの場合は0、GRANTEDキューの場合は1、CONVERTキューの場合は2

STATE

VARCHAR2(64)

所有者に表示されるロックの状態

AST_EVENT0

NUMBER

最新のASTイベント

OWNER_NODE

NUMBER

ノード識別子

BLOCKED

NUMBER

このロック要求が他からブロックされている場合は1、ブロックされていない場合は0

BLOCKER

NUMBER

このロックが他をブロックしている場合は1、ブロックしていない場合は0

CON_ID

NUMBER

データが関係するコンテナのID。可能な値は次のとおり。

  • 0: この値は、CDB全体に関連するデータを含む行に使用される。この値は、非CDB内の行にも使用される。

  • 1: この値は、ルートのみに関連するデータを含む行に使用される

  • n: nは、データを含む行に適用されるコンテナID